17 Example 2 Solve a System with No Solution ANSWER Because solving the system resulted in the false statement 0 8, the original system of equations has no solution. =

20 Example 3 Solve a System with Infinitely Many Solutions ANSWER Because solving the system resulted in the true statement 0 0, the original system of equations has infinitely many solutions. The three planes intersect in a line. =
